Robert Christy, comp. Proverbs, Maxims and Phrases of All Ages. 1887.

Moon

Moon is made of green cheese.Rabelais, Butler.

Oh, swear not by the moon, the inconstant moon.Shakespeare.

The moon does not heed the barking of dogs.

The moon is a moon whether it shine or not.

The moon’s not seen when the sun shines.

What does the moon care if the dogs bark at her?
